HDBaseT — 100-Meter Uncompressed Transmission

HDBaseT transmits uncompressed 4K video, multi-channel audio, Ethernet, and control signals over a single Cat.5e/6/7 cable up to 100 meters at 20Gbps — with zero signal degradation, zero latency, and no need for expensive fiber converters or active repeaters. This dramatically simplifies cabling infrastructure in large auditoriums, reduces installation labor costs, and minimizes long-term maintenance.

Laser-Phosphor Light Source — 25,000-Hour Lifespan

The solid-state laser-phosphor engine is rated for 20,000h Normal / 25,000h ECO — over 13 years at 8 hours per day. Unlike traditional UHP lamps that dim progressively and require costly replacements every 3,000–5,000 hours, the laser source maintains consistent brightness and color accuracy throughout its lifespan. Additional benefits include instant on/off, approximately 30% lower energy consumption, and mercury-free construction for sustainable deployment.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How do DLP projectors compare to LCD projectors?

A: DLP projectors use a DMD chip with millions of microscopic mirrors to reflect light, delivering high contrast, deep blacks, and fast switching with no panel aging. LCD/3LCD projectors pass light through liquid-crystal panels, producing smooth, bright color without the rainbow effect. Both are widely used in professional projection; the best choice depends on your venue, ambient light, and content.

Q: What is the difference between short-throw and long-throw projectors?

A: Short-throw projectors use a wide lens to create a large image from a very short distance, ideal for tight spaces and minimizing shadows. Long-throw projectors are mounted farther away and suit large auditoriums and venues. Match the lens and throw ratio to your room size and screen.

Q: What types of projector screens are available?

A: Common screen types include fixed-frame, motorized/roll-down, portable tripod, and ambient-light-rejecting (ALR) screens. Screen gain and material affect brightness and viewing angle. For high-lumen projectors, low-gain matte or ALR screens help avoid hotspots in large venues.

Q: How do I set up an outdoor movie projector?

A: For outdoor projection, choose a bright projector to overcome ambient light, use a taut, wrinkle-free screen or a suitable wall, ensure stable power and weather protection, and control light around the viewing area.

Q: How do 1080p and 4K projectors compare?

A: 1080p projectors output about 2 million pixels, while 4K projectors deliver roughly four times the detail for sharper large-screen images. Many professional projectors use WUXGA (1920x1200) panels with 4K signal support, balancing brightness, detail, and cost.

Q: How do projector brightness and contrast ratio relate?

A: Brightness (ANSI lumens) determines how well an image competes with ambient light and how large it can be projected, while contrast ratio defines the difference between the darkest and brightest parts of an image, affecting depth and detail. High brightness and high contrast ensure vivid, readable images in large-venue environments.
